I would like to suggest an enhancement to make UMG integrate with the Amazon S3 storage like you have done with your UVG product.  In this case you would gain the same benefits you do with UVG:
- use Amazon's bandwith and storage (very cheap prices)
- let users upload unlimited amounts of photos (since it is so cheap)
- ease of portability = you can move your site to any host without worrying about moving large amounts of user data.
